debug 0.0.5

Download Url: PonerineM-0.0.5-debug.apk (8.08MB)

debug 0.0.5 Features:
1. Added photo mode (very very very simple), please set "Switch to Photo Mode" to ON before connect. Photo mode will not rename and stay in the original folder. Use your own custom autoexec.ash to set the shooting parameters;
2. Added "Move Duplicated Files" option for video shooting with "Rename by Scene" is ON, the duplicated files will be moved to folder /trashbin in the tf card, and the video files won't be deleted.

debug 0.0.4 bugs fixed:
1. Cam name wrong display format issue;
2. telnet in Mac OSX can't rename issue;

debug 0.0.3 Features:
1. Control upto 8 YiCams running in WiFi station mode;
2. Create sync sound on record start or stop;
3. Automatically rename video files via telnet port;
4. Enabled liveview to VLC for android.

Preparation:
1. User shell scripts (click me) or PonerineS (click me) , change all the YiCams to WiFi station mode one by one;
2. Make sure telnet is enabled in autoexec.ash as:
Code:
lu_util exec telnetd -l/bin/sh
3. Android phone must connect to the same WiFi as YiCams;

How to use:
1. Camera status:
after install the apk, by default there's only cam1 shows with name default and ip 192.168.42.1;
001.png
2. Setting menu:
click the top right corner label: For XiaoYi Sport Camera , will popup setting menu:
002.png
3. Camera setting:
[Camera Enabled] - add to connect list;
[Camera Name] - display name in main screen;
[Preview] - ON after connect, preview in VLC for android;
003.png
4. Advanced setting:
[Scene Name] & [Counter] - video custom rename rules;
[Rename by Scene] - ON will apply rename video files;
[Buzzer on Record Start] & [Buzzer on Record Stop] - camera will buzzer for 1~2 times after record starts or before record stops. this function is used for multi-cam video files synchronization;
[Volume Low on Disconnect] - after apk connect all the cams, buzzer volume will be set to mute. ON cams will resume to low buzzer volume, for the status judgement.
[Load Camera Setting] - ON after connect will check the cams resolution setting, better set to OFF.
004.png

[Camera Rename Rule] (updated in debug 0.0.5)
by default video files will store in folder: /DCIM/100MEDIA (or 101MEDIA, 102MEDIA, ...)
if [Rename by Scene] - ON, after record finish, apk will automatically rename to:
[YYYYMMDD]-[Scene Name]-[Counter][Camera].mp4
and move to folder: /DCIM/[Scene Name]

for example: Today is 2015-09-17, [Scene Name] is "running", [Camera] 1,2,3~8 will use letter a,b,c~h, [Counter] 2-digit starts from 01 automatic increase 1 for next file.
1st record will be:
CAM1: the video file will be rename and moved to folder: /DCIM/running/20150917-running-01a.mp4
CAM2: the video file will be rename and moved to folder: /DCIM/running/20150917-running-01b.mp4
...
CAM8: the video file will be rename and moved to folder: /DCIM/running/20150917-running-01h.mp4

2nd record will be:
CAM1: the video file will be rename and moved to folder: /DCIM/running/20150917-running-02a.mp4
CAM2: the video file will be rename and moved to folder: /DCIM/running/20150917-running-02b.mp4
...
CAM8: the video file will be rename and moved to folder: /DCIM/running/20150917-running-02h.mp4

if change the [Scene Name] to "swimming", [Counter] will reset to 1.

1. yes, all cams need to enter station mode when connect to wireless router;
2. better use wireless router if you need to connect to 6 or more cams; cos xiaoyi ap mode, can only connect max 5 client ( 1 of these will used by mobile phone already, so totally can use 5 cam: 1 ap & 4 sta);

Andy_S posted the following regarding time-syncing multiple Yi cameras:

It DOES work. If you want time-sync your cameras, you just need to launch this shell command
ntpd -q -m -p your.ntp.host.IP
-q : quit after host clock is set
-m : don't daemonize (runs in forward)
-p : peer address
After that just do sleep 1 & trigger SOMEHOW the shutter. it COULD sync... (provided cameras process the trigger itself at the same speed...)
You have to realize, that to sync perfectly you cannot have more deviation than 1/250s of the recording start.
The purpose of synchronizing cameras this way would be to enable high-quality 360 video capture. Even if cameras are started close to the same time, without accurate sync there are stitching artifacts in the final stitched 360 inage.

Do you think it would be possible to integrate a "synced start" feature into PomerineM? I'm running a rig with (luckily) 8 cameras, and ntpd sync would be such a huge breakthrough for myself and many others.

Hi @jreinjr
I've read Andy_S idea about time-sync from internet time server. But I think that way mostly for picture mode (timelapse).
In video mode, I don't need to 100% sametime to start multiple cam. just start all cams, and make a buzzer by app, later in VR software can automatically sync the video use that buzzer sound.

Hi lucky, thanks for the reply :)

I'm already able to line up my videos based on the audio track in software. However, what we're looking for is a way to start all cameras within a few milliseconds of each other.

To explain why - imagine we're shooting at 60fps. That means that, even with software sync, two cameras can be 1/120th of a second out of sync with each other. If one camera starts "half a frame" after another camera, they can't be truly synchronized in software. This is the main problem with all current DIY VR rigs. It may not seem like a big deal, but it is extremely important for capturing 3D 360 video.

Using WiFi to directly trigger all cams won't work - the delay is too slow. However, syncing the internal clocks of the cameras (which are accurate to the millisecond) and then telling the cams to start filming at a specific time in the future could theoretically start all cameras within a few milliseconds - right?
